I got app, which can send twits.

I do it in this way:

- (IBAction)twitDream:(id)sender
{
    if ([TWTweetComposeViewController canSendTweet]) {
        TWTweetComposeViewController *tweet = 
        [[TWTweetComposeViewController alloc] init];
        if (dream.image != [UIImage imageNamed:@"blank-photo.png"])
        [tweet addImage:dream.image];
        NSString *twitMsg = [dreamField.text stringByAppendingString:@" send via Dreamer"];
        [tweet setInitialText:twitMsg];
        [self presentModalViewController:tweet animated:YES];
    } else {
        //can't tweet!
    }
}

What should i do when [TWTweetComposeViewController canSendTweet] is equal to NO ? And when it is equal to NO ?

    That is full solution code:

    - (IBAction)twitDream:(id)sender
    {
        if ([TWTweetComposeViewController canSendTweet]) {
            TWTweetComposeViewController *tweet = 
            [[TWTweetComposeViewController alloc] init];
            if (dream.image != [UIImage imageNamed:@"blank-photo.png"]) {[tweet addImage:dream.image];}
            NSString *twitMsg = [dreamField.text stringByAppendingString:@" #Dreamer"];
            [tweet setInitialText:twitMsg];
            [self presentModalViewController:tweet animated:YES];
        } else {
            UIAlertView *alertView = [[UIAlertView alloc] 
                                      initWithTitle:@"Sorry"                                                             
                                      message:@"You can't send a tweet right now, make sure your device has an internet connection and you have at least one Twitter account setup"                                                          
                                      delegate:self                                              
                                      cancelButtonTitle:@"OK"                                                   
                                      otherButtonTitles:nil];
            [alertView show];
        }
    }
